Meet the Friends of Short Hills Park for a guided bird hike. We should see a great variety of birds! Guided walks will be held at 7:30 and 9:30am, starting at the Pelham Road parking lot. Bring binoculars and wear warm, layered clothing and sturdy footwear for a 3km hike with steep uphill sections. All ages are welcome; 14 and under must be accompanied by a parent or guardian.

The Friends of Short Hills Park is a community-based organization dedicated to preserving the cultural and natural integrity of Short Hills Provincial Park through liaison with Ontario Parks, volunteer work, public education and fund raising activities. Find out more:
